Exactly How Do Emulsifiers Function?
Exactly how do emulsifiers develop secure combinations from two usually unmixable liquids? Emulsifiers function by lowering the surface area tension in between oil and water, which are inherently incompatible as a result of their molecular frameworks. They possess both hydrophilic (water-attracting) and hydrophobic (water-repelling) residential or commercial properties, permitting them to communicate with both stages. When an emulsifier is introduced to a mixture of oil and water, its particles place themselves at the interface, with the hydrophilic end in the water and the hydrophobic end in the oil. This arrangement supports the emulsion by stopping the oil droplets from integrating and dividing from the water stage. The result is a consistent mixture, called an emulsion, which can be either oil-in-water or water-in-oil, relying on the predominant phase. Because of this, emulsifiers play an essential duty in different items, making sure consistency and security in formulas varying from food things to cosmetics.
Kinds of Emulsifiers in Food Products
In the domain of food manufacturing, various sorts of emulsifiers are employed to boost appearance, security, and general quality. These emulsifiers can be categorized primarily into natural and artificial kinds. Natural emulsifiers, such as lecithin, originated from soybeans or egg yolks, are generally made use of in products like mayo and chocolates. They are favored for their tidy label allure and functional advantages.
Artificial emulsifiers, like mono- and diglycerides, are often used in refined foods for their cost-effectiveness and adaptability. These compounds aid preserve the preferred uniformity in items such as margarine and salad dressings. In addition, polysorbates, one more classification of artificial emulsifiers, boost the security of emulsions in ice creams and sauces. Each type of emulsifier plays an essential function in making certain the desired sensory qualities and shelf-life of food items, inevitably improving the customer experience.
